6. It is Done! (Revelation 21:6)


I Will Give: The third I-testimony of God in His speech from the throne, “I will give…”, describes His dealing with the Church of Jesus Christ by grace as well as with all who search for Him and are hungry after His peace and righteousness.

God is an always giving God; He sacrificed Himself in His Son so as to rescue his fallen creation from the righteous judgment. Every day God is giving us freely out of His fullness righteousness, peace and strength. If parents in this world who often think and act doubtfully may give their children good gifts again and again, how much more will our Father in heaven give freely to His spiritual children all necessary earthly and heavenly goods (Luke 11:9-13)! However, like David we are world champions in forgetting and must therefore exhort ourselves over and over again, “And forget not all his benefits!” (Psalm 103:2). We ought to repent eagerly and learn to thank our Father in heaven for all His earthly and heavenly gifts with all our heart. For he promised the listeners, “Whoever offers praise glorifies me: and to him that orders his conversation aright will I show the salvation of God.” (Psalm 50:23).

I Will Give to the Thirsty: There are people who think of being satisfied, knowing all things, having done the necessary and having all what they need for live and death. These people are like the leader of the church in Laodicea with whom Jesus was disgusted (Revelation 3:14-16). To this reach man, who was content with himself, the Son of God said, “You do not know that you are wretched, and miserable, and poor, and blind, and naked.” (Revelation 3:17).

After the revelation of the glorious future of God's children in the presence of their father the All-Merciful addresses His words directly to the churches in Minor Asia which were in part poor or had already to live under an increasing political pressure. (Revelation 2:8-11). Jesus did not promise them that he will rescue them from the upcoming persecutions, but he revealed them his love instead. This love is especially for those who are not content with their own godliness, purity, truth and love, even if these people do not know God and His love. All people searching for God, His Son and His Spirit are loved by the Father.

Whoever is hungry for the righteousness of God and is searching for peace for his guilty conscience, will be blessed by Jesus (Matthew 5:6). Whoever is thirsty for knowledge of God and His will and repents, will be anointed with the Holy Spirit who even searches the deep things of God (1 Corinthians 2:10-12). Unless we are born again we are not able to know the Kingdom of God (John 3:3). Without the Spirit of the Father there is no knowledge of the Son (Mathew 16:17; 1 Corinthians 12:3; 1 John 2:23; and other verses). Therefore the Almighty and His Lamb promise to satisfy our thirst for God and His Son (Revelation 22:17).
